Jesus spoke to them, saying, "Be of good cheer! It is I; do not be afraid." — Matthew 14:27 NKJV When the disciples saw Jesus in the middle of their stormy night, they called him a ghost. A phantom. To them, the glow was anything but God. When we see gentle lights on the horizon, we often have the same reaction. We dismiss occasional kindness as apparitions, accidents, or anomalies. Anything but God. And because we look for the bonfire, we miss the candle. Because we listen for the shout, we miss the whisper. But it is in burnished candles that God comes, and through whispered promises he speaks: "When you doubt, look around; I am closer than you think." ~In the Eye of the Storm * |

The Lord is close to everyone who prays to Him, to all who truly pray to Him. — Psalm 145:18 Healing begins when we do something. Healing begins when we reach out. Healing starts when we take a step. God's help is near and always available, but it is only given to those who seek it. Nothing results from apathy. God honors radical, risk-taking faith. When arks are built, lives are saved. When soldiers march, Jerichos tumble. When staffs are raised, seas still open. When a lunch is shared, thousands are fed. And when a garment is touched — whether by the hand of an anemic woman in Galilee or by the prayers of a beggar in Bangladesh — Jesus stops. He stops and responds. ~He Still Moves Stones * |
